Dr. Ruiz Urges Participation in the 2020 Census
The September 30th deadline to fill out the 2020 Census is just around the corner. Right now, our district is falling behind. Only 57.8% of CA-36 has responded to the Census--that's 10% less than the statewide self-response rate for California!
A new Congressional report has revealed just what's at stake if we don't have a complete and accurate Census count for our district. Read more here.
As we face our current public health and economic crisis, it is very important for our community to secure the funding we need for health care systems, schools, community centers, job programs, and more.
I encourage everyone to respond to the Census right away by filling out the safe and secure Census form at my2020census.gov or by calling 844-330-2020! You will only be asked 12 questions and you will not be asked about citizenship status.
